Skyfish is a full stack, end-to-end American drone platform manufacturer.
The Skyfish platform consists of drones (Skyfish M4, Skyfish M6), an onboard computer autonomous flight engine (Skymind), a remote controller (Skyfish C1), flight planning and navigation software (Skyfish Mission Control), and a web portal for processing, storing, viewing, and analyzing 3D models, flown images, and maps (Skyportal).
The Skyfish platform enables engineering-grade precision measurement and analysis of critical infrastructure assets using high quality photogrammetry sensors for producing “crystal clear” 3D reality models. Skyfish offers broad sensor and payload support for various industry use case requirements, including photogrammetry for 3D modeling, LiDAR, gas detection, thermal imaging, and environment-aware robotic interactions.
